Web1 de nov. de 2024 · Cocos Tectonic Plate. The Cocos Plate is a relatively small-sized, triangular-shaped oceanic plate located beneath the Pacific Ocean, off the west coast of Central America. It is named after Cocos Island, the only emergent island on the plate.
